Potassium Pyrosulfate, also known as dipotassium disulfate, possesses the molecular formula K2O7S2. This signifies a compound composed of two potassium ions and the pyrosulfate anion. Its molecular weight is approximately 254.32 g/mol. Physically, it is typically observed as a white crystal or crystalline powder. The key functional properties of Potassium Pyrosulfate stem from its acidic nature. When dissolved in water, it hydrolyzes to form potassium bisulfate, resulting in a strongly acidic solution. This characteristic makes it an effective acidic solvent, capable of dissolving substances that are otherwise difficult to process. This property is fundamental to its utility in various analytical procedures, including the decomposition of certain minerals and metal oxides, and as an inclusion agent in steel analysis for electrolytic metal determination.
Specifications for Potassium Pyrosulfate are critical for ensuring its suitability for specific applications. A high-purity grade typically boasts an assay of ≥98.0% Potassium Pyrosulfate. Furthermore, a low content of impurities is equally important. Manufacturers commonly specify limits for:
- Water insoluble matter: ≤0.01%
- Chloride: ≤0.01%
- Phosphate: ≤0.01%
